Balcony removal services involve the safe and efficient dismantling of existing balconies on residential or commercial properties. These services typically include the careful deconstruction of the balcony structure, removal of debris, and proper disposal or recycling of materials. Professionals ensure that the removal process minimizes disturbance to the building’s integrity and adheres to safety standards, making the space ready for future modifications or renovations.

Removing a balcony can address several common issues. Over time, balconies may develop structural damage, rust, or deterioration that compromises safety and aesthetic appeal. In some cases, balconies may no longer meet building codes or design preferences, prompting property owners to opt for removal. Eliminating an outdated or unsafe balcony can also free up space for other outdoor features or improve the overall appearance of the property.

Cost Range for Balcony Removal - The typical cost for removing a balcony varies between $2,000 and $6,000, depending on size and complexity. Larger or more intricate balconies tend to be on the higher end of the spectrum.

Factors Affecting Pricing - Costs can fluctuate based on the materials used, structural considerations, and accessibility. For example, a small concrete balcony may cost around $3,000, while a larger wooden structure could be closer to $5,500.

Additional Expenses - Additional charges may include debris disposal and site cleanup, which can add approximately $200 to $800 to the total. These costs vary depending on the scope of work and local service providers.

What is involved in balcony removal services? Balcony removal services typically include the safe dismantling and disposal of existing balconies, ensuring the structure is removed without damaging the building.

Why might someone choose to remove a balcony? Individuals may opt for balcony removal to improve safety, increase outdoor space, or prepare for renovations or building modifications.

Are there any permits required for balcony removal? Permit requirements vary by location; it is advisable to check with local building authorities or consult with a professional service provider.

How long does balcony removal usually take? The duration depends on the size and complexity of the balcony, but a typical removal process can range from a few hours to a full day.

Can balcony removal be combined with other renovation services? Yes, balcony removal can often be coordinated with other exterior renovation or remodeling projects to streamline the process.
